Warning Signs You Need Cabinet Water Damage Repair

Musty odors, water-stained walls, and warped cabinets are just a few signs that you need Cabinet Water Damage Repair. Catching these issues early can save you money and prevent bigger problems down the line.

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Don’t ignore musty odors that linger in your kitchen or bathroom. This could be a sign of hidden moisture or mold growth, which can lead to serious health problems and costly repairs.

Water-Stained Walls and Ceilings

Address water-stained walls and ceilings quickly to prevent further damage and potential safety hazards. Our team will assess the damage and develop a plan to repair and restore your walls and ceilings.

Warped or Buckled Cabinets

Don’t delay repairs if you notice warped or buckled cabinets. This can be a sign of structural damage or water damage that needs immediate attention.

Visible Water Damage or Leaks

Act fast if you notice visible water damage or leaks in your kitchen or bathroom. Our team will respond quickly to assess the damage and develop a plan to repair and restore your cabinets and surrounding areas.

Unpleasant Odors or Discoloration

Don’t ignore unpleasant odors or discoloration in your kitchen or bathroom. This could be a sign of mold growth or water damage that needs professional attention.

Visible Signs of Mold Growth

Act quickly if you notice visible signs of mold growth in your kitchen or bathroom. Our team will respond quickly to assess the damage and develop a plan to remediate the mold and restore your cabinets and surrounding areas.

Cabinet Water Damage Repair v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small water leak or minor damage Yes No DIY repairs can be effective for small, minor issues.
Visible water damage or structural issues No Yes Visible water damage or structural issues need professional attention to prevent further damage and safety hazards.
Burst pipe or significant water loss No Yes Burst pipes or significant water loss need immediate professional attention to prevent further damage and safety hazards.
Mold growth or unpleasant odors No Yes Mold growth or unpleasant odors need professional attention to remediate and prevent further damage.
Large or complex repairs No Yes Large or complex repairs need professional expertise and equipment to ensure effective and safe repairs.
Water damage in hidden areas (e.g., behind cabinets) No Yes Water damage in hidden areas needs professional attention to detect and repair the issue effectively.

Cabinet Water Damage Repair Cost in Heath, TX

The cost of Cabinet Water Damage Repair in Heath, TX varies depending on the severity and size of the affected area, as well as local conditions. Our estimates range from $500 to $2,500 or more, depending on the scope of the project.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water removal and drying $500 – $2,000 The size of the affected area and the amount of water present.
Cabinet repair and refinishing $1,000 – $3,000 The extent of the damage and the type of materials needed for repair.
Final inspection and completion $200 – $500 The complexity of the repairs and the amount of time required for completion.
More services (e.g., mold remediation) $500 – $2,000 The extent of the mold growth and the required scope of work.
Emergency services (e.g., burst pipe response) $1,000 – $5,000 The severity of the situation and the required response time.
Customized plans and services $500 – $2,000 The complexity of the project and the required scope of work.

Keep in mind that these estimates are subject to change based on the specifics of your situation. Our team will provide you with a detailed quote after assessing the damage and developing a customized plan for your Cabinet Water Damage Repair project.
